摘要: 1、下载 https://www.elastic.co/cn/downloads/elasticsearch#ga-release 2、上传Linux并解压 我上传的目录是 /home/softwware 解压 tar -zxvf elasticsearch-7.4.2-linux-x86_64.t 阅读全文
posted @ 2021-09-02 15:23 金盛年华 阅读(317) 评论(0) 推荐(0)
摘要: 打开cmd netstat -ano # 列出所有端口的使用情况 netstat -aon|findstr "8081" # 查看指定端口,最后一位数字就是 PID tasklist|findstr "9088" # 查看指定 PID 的进程 taskkill /T /F /PID 9088 # 强 阅读全文
posted @ 2021-09-02 14:21 金盛年华 阅读(69) 评论(0) 推荐(0)
摘要: 实现 HandlerInterceptor 接口,编写拦截器 package com.jinsh.controller.Interceptor; import com.jinsh.utils.JSONResult; import com.jinsh.utils.JsonUtils; import c 阅读全文
posted @ 2021-09-02 02:03 金盛年华 阅读(100) 评论(0) 推荐(0)
摘要: CAP 概念 C(Consistency):一致性 在分布式系统中,所有的计算机节点的数据在同一时刻都是相同的,数据都是一致的。不能因为分布式导致不同系统拿到的数据不一致。也就是说,用户在某一个节点写了数据,在其他节点获得该数据的值是最新的;如若是更新操作,那么所有用户看到的也是更新后的新的值,不论 阅读全文
posted @ 2021-09-02 01:59 金盛年华 阅读(276) 评论(0) 推荐(0)
摘要: 分布式会话 什么是会话? 会话Session代表的是客户端与服务器的一次交互过程,这个过程可以是连续也可以是时断时续的。曾经的Servlet时代(jsp),一旦用户与服务端交互,服务器tomcat就会为用户创建一个session,同时前端会有一个jsessionid,每次交互都会携带。如此一来,服务 阅读全文
posted @ 2021-09-02 01:35 金盛年华 阅读(310) 评论(0) 推荐(0)
摘要: 缓存穿透 用户用一个不存在的id(比如-1)发起请求查询数据,缓存和数据库中都没有这条数据,如果此时有人恶意发起大量的请求,由于缓存中没有数据,那么这些请求将直接打到数据库层,给数据库带来压力。 解决方案:第一次查询结果为null时,可以放一个字符串空("")到缓存里,这样后面再次相同的请求就会获得 阅读全文
posted @ 2021-09-01 15:09 金盛年华 阅读(40) 评论(0) 推荐(0)
摘要: Redis 集群 主从复制以及哨兵模式可以提高读的并发,但是单个master容量有限,数据达到一定程度会有瓶颈,这个时候可以通过水平扩展为多master-slave成为集群,支持海量数据,实现高可用与高并发。 哨兵模式其实也是一种集群,他能够提高读请求的并发,但是容错方面可能会有一些问题,比如mas 阅读全文
posted @ 2021-09-01 01:18 金盛年华 阅读(96) 评论(0) 推荐(0)
摘要: 主从原理 redis主从原理就是一个读写分离。 当slave启动后会向master发送一个ping,告知master我已启动,然后master会将内存中的最新数据全量存储到RDB文件,然后传输给slave。slave将RDB文件先存储到本地硬盘,再读取到内存中。这样主从数据就同步了。 当第一次的数据 阅读全文
posted @ 2021-08-31 15:07 金盛年华 阅读(678) 评论(0) 推荐(0)
摘要: RDB (redis database) 1、什么是RDB 每隔一段时间,把内存中的数据写入磁盘临时文件,作为快照,恢复的时候把快照文件读进内存。如果宕机重启,再次启动redis后,快照数据会恢复到内存。 2、备份与恢复 内存备份 → 磁盘临时文件 磁盘临时文件 → 恢复到内存 3、RDB优劣 优势 阅读全文
posted @ 2021-08-31 13:46 金盛年华 阅读(52) 评论(0) 推荐(0)
摘要: SpringBoot整合Redis pom引入redis依赖 <!-- 引入 redis 依赖 --> <dependency> <groupId>org.springframework.boot</groupId> <artifactId>spring-boot-starter-data-redi 阅读全文
posted @ 2021-08-30 18:44 金盛年华 阅读(37) 评论(0) 推荐(0)